概括
室内空气污染对公共健康构成重大风险,因为人们90%以上的时间都在室内度过. 需要进一步的研究来了解室内空气质量 (IAQ) 和其对健康的影响.

背景情况:
- 官方的空气污染控制历史上专注于户外环境.
- 在建筑物中,室内污染物的度较高是普遍存在的.
- 城市人口在室内度过90%以上的时间,增加了暴露风险.
研究的目的:
- 突出与室内空气污染相关的公共卫生问题.
- 识别关键的室内空气污染物及其对健康的影响.
- 为了强调当前室内空气污染风险评估的局限性.
主要方法:
- 审查有关室内空气质量和暴露模式的现有证据.
- 识别常见的室内污染物,如环境烟草烟雾,,一氧化碳,二氧化,甲,石棉,微生物和空气过敏原.
- 对了解暴露水平和健康后果的数据差距的分析.
主要成果:
- 室内空气污染是一个重大的问题,因为高占用率和污染物度比室外更高.
- 主要的室内污染物包括被动烟雾,,CO,NO2,甲,石棉,微生物和空气过敏原.
- 目前的风险评估受到暴露程度,模式和健康结果的数据不足的限制.
结论:
- 要解决室内空气污染问题,必须制定全面的战略.
- 这一战略应包括对室内暴露,健康影响,控制措施和政策替代方案的调查.
- 进一步的研究对于减轻室内空气污染物的健康风险至关重要.

Asthma I: Introduction
Asthma is a chronic inflammatory disorder of the airways characterized by variable airflow obstruction and heightened bronchial responsiveness to a wide range of triggers. The underlying inflammation leads to airway swelling, mucus hypersecretion, and smooth muscle constriction, all of which narrow the airway lumen and impede airflow. Chronic Obstructive Pulmonary Disease I: Introduction
Chronic obstructive pulmonary disease is a common, preventable, and treatable respiratory disorder characterized by persistent symptoms and progressive airflow limitation.
